An Episcopal parish with two female reverends and a congregation with a strong gay and lesbian contingent (50%), St. Luke in the Fields is not only progressive but pro-active. The Parish House was once the childhood home of author Bret Harte, whose 1868 story The Luck of Roaring Camp told of the macho world of the California Gold Rush.
